Rescue FAQs

Our mission statement: To improve the lives of pets in need by providing rescue, foster care, education, training support, and adoption into safe, loving homes.
Grand County - the towns of Winter Park, Granby, Fraser, Tabernash, Hot Sulphur Springs and Kremmling

Additional adoption info

We require adoption papers to be signed, and we visit the pet and their new owner before and after the adoption to make sure everyone is happy and doing well.

Alliance for Contraception in Cats and Dogs

There is a tremendous need for new methods of sterilization that are faster, easier, more accessible, and less expensive than surgery. ACC&D works tirelessly to bring together key stakeholders to advance this field.
